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:01 Der er 13 kommentarer og
1 løsning

hvilken datatype?

Davs.
Jeg har nogle celler i min tabel i databasen. Men når jeg i min input-boks f.eks. skriver Eksperten.dk så står der kun E i cellen!
-Jeg ved godt at dette højst sansynligt er fordi at jeg har sat den til maks at indeholde ét tegn. Men nu er jeg ved at lave en database, til min madside, og der skal jeg bruge en celle uden loft! Hvad skal den sættes til? Og kan jeg i princippet ikke sætte dem alle til det, eller bliver det langsommere eller hvad sker der? Der må jo være en grund til at ALLE sætter et loft på :O)

-Jeg glæder mig til at høre jeres svar.
-På forhånd tak

/Madviden.dk
Avatar billede disky Nybegynder
16. april 2002 - 22:03 #1
Brug 'Text'
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:04 #2
Jeg har sat den til text, men den viser stadig kun én (!) ...
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:05 #3
ups ... havde sat længden til én (!) ...men hvis jeg ikke angiver længden så forbliver den uden loft ... ikke?  Jeg vil stadig gerne have svar på de andre sp-  :O)
Avatar billede disky Nybegynder
16. april 2002 - 22:05 #4
hmmm,
post lige tabel definitionen
Avatar billede disky Nybegynder
16. april 2002 - 22:06 #5
du kan godt sætte dem alle til det, men pga flydende længde bliver performance dårligere, og man skal normalt kun bruge de typer man reelt har brug for
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:06 #6
Hvis nu den står på tinytext, er der så et forud sat loft på?
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:09 #7
hmm... den fjernede  lige mit indlæg... selvom jeg havde set det stod der (da jeg trykkede opdatér)..
Jeg gentager:  :O)
Hvis jeg har sat den til tinytext, er der så et forud programmeret loft på?
Avatar billede disky Nybegynder
16. april 2002 - 22:10 #8
ja det er der.

tinyint kan have værdier imellem -128 og 127
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:12 #9
jeg mener tinytext, og ikke tinyint !  :O)
Nu kommer der et dumt spørgsmål ...
Hvordan kan den være minus???
Avatar billede disky Nybegynder
16. april 2002 - 22:19 #10
damm, jeg tror snart jeg skal i seng, jeg kan ikke engang læse mere.

TINYBLOB, TINYTEXT  L+1 bytes, where L < 2^8  altså max 256 tegn
BLOB, TEXT  L+2 bytes, where L < 2^16  altså max 65536 tegn
MEDIUMBLOB, MEDIUMTEXT  L+3 bytes, where L < 2^24  altså max 1677216 tegn
LONGBLOB, LONGTEXT  L+4 bytes, where L < 2^32  altså max 4 milliarder tegn
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:27 #11
okay ...
ET sidste spørgsmål ... kan jeg ikke sætte loft på text??? Som sagt stod den før på en, men når jeg i phpmyadmin prøver at ændre det, ændrer den intet!
Avatar billede disky Nybegynder
16. april 2002 - 22:30 #12
mystisk, jeg mener ikke man kan sætte en længde på den
Avatar billede disky Nybegynder
16. april 2002 - 22:30 #13
kan først svare imorgen igen, da jeg skal i seng, jeg har svært ved at holde øjnene åbne.
Avatar billede madviden.dk Nybegynder
16. april 2002 - 22:33 #14
okay ...
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ester